Graphics director
Paiching Wei
Bay Area News Group graphics director Pai, aka Paiching Wei, manages and creates news information graphics, illustrations and other visuals that appear online at MercuryNews.com and EastBayTimes.com and in print in the East Bay Times and The Mercury News. He is a graduate of UC Davis with a BS degree in design.
